The requirement
North Carolina active attorneys subject to CLE must complete 12 hours of approved CLE each year, including at least 2 hours of professional responsibility (ethics) and (as required in designated years) technology or substance-abuse / mental-health credits under the NC State Bar CLE rules.
| CLE credits per cycle | 12 |
|---|---|
| Ethics or professionalism subset | 2 |
| Cycle | calendar year |
